Location Profile - Woking

Thanks to Ben Williams / Keith Gunner for the details about this location

Main stabling point for Balfour Beatty and AMEC stock.

Directions

The yards can be viewed from passing trains towards the south and north beyond, and west of, Woking station. Most OTP now stables on the north side, best viewed from trains on the main line to Basingstoke, although there are several pedestrian viewing points (Poole Road (the entrance to the up yard), the Morrison supermarket car park further west, the overbridges across the Basingstoke and Guildford lines, and the entrance road to the down yard and Days aggregates depot).

Usual machines

BB Tampers and TRAMMS and an AMEC Tamper. Wet Spot Machine 76401 is normally stabled on the south side, together with the occasional MPV, a Harsco or other Grinder and a Stoneblower.
